Roasted Acorn Squash with Quinoa Stuffing The Vegan Atlas

Preheat your oven to 400F (200C). Halve the squash and use a spoon to scoop out the seeds and stringy bits. Divide the oil over the 4 squash halves and use your fingers or a brush to spread the oil over the squash flesh. Bake cut side facing down on a baking pan for 25 - 35 minutes until the squash is fork-tender.

Crispy Tofu Stuffed Sweet and Spicy Acorn Squash

Preheat the oven to 400°F (204°C). Cut the squash in half vertically (from north to south), and scoop out the seeds. Brush the insides with the oil and sprinkle with salt and pepper. Finally, set the halves cut side up on a baking sheet and bake for 45 to 60 minutes, until fork tender. Step 2: Cook the vegetables.

Vegan Stuffed Acorn Squash Kelly Jones Nutrition

Instructions. Preheat oven to 400 degrees F. Cut acorn squash in half and scoop out the insides. Drizzle with olive oil and sprinkle with salt and pepper. Roast cut side up for for about 35-50 minutes or until your squash is tender in the middle and browned around the edges. (The timing will depend on your squash.
